Workflow13 / 15
Progress:
- Identify target market's #1 pain point for quiz title hook
- Map 6-9 questions covering VAK preferences and daily struggles
- Design multi-layered scoring (VAK + DISC + Schwartz awareness)
- Create 3-4 result variations with personalized recommendations
- Build nurture sequence upsell tiers
- Set up ScoreApp integration with email platform
Question Design Process:
- Start with emotional day-to-day scenarios they relate to
- Embed VAK language patterns in answer choices
- Layer in Schwartz awareness indicators (problem-aware, solution-aware, etc.)
- Include one "aha moment" question that reframes their thinking

Examples18 / 20
Example 1 - Fitness Coach: Input: Target market of busy moms wanting to lose weight Output:
- Title: "Why Your Weight Loss Attempts Keep Failing (It's Not Willpower)"
- Question: "When you think about your ideal body, what motivates you most?"
- A) Seeing myself in those old photos again (Visual)
- B) Hearing compliments about how great I look (Auditory)
- C) Feeling confident and energetic throughout the day (Kinesthetic)
Example 2 - Business Coach: Input: Target market of struggling consultants Output:
- Title: "What's Really Blocking Your 6-Figure Consulting Business?"
- Question: "Your biggest frustration with client work is..."
- A) Not having clear systems to show results (Visual/Problem-Aware)
- B) Difficulty explaining your value proposition (Auditory/Problem-Aware)
- C) Feeling overwhelmed by inconsistent income (Kinesthetic/Problem-Aware)

Best Practices
- Quiz length: 6-9 questions maximum (completion rates drop after 9)
- Question flow: Start emotional → get specific → end with transformation vision
- Answer options: Always include all 3 VAK preferences per question
- Result pages: Write in their dominant communication style
- Scoring layers: Weight VAK (40%), Schwartz awareness (35%), DISC (25%)
- Call-to-action: Match the prospect's readiness level (educational for problem-aware, solution-focused for product-aware)
Common Pitfalls
- Generic titles - Must address specific pain points, not broad topics
- Too many result variations - Stick to 3-4 clear categories maximum
- Missing emotional hooks - Questions must reflect their daily internal dialogue
- One-dimensional scoring - Always layer multiple psychological frameworks
- Weak result pages - Avoid generic advice; make it feel personally crafted
- No clear next step - Each result needs specific nurture sequence entry point
- Forgetting mobile optimization - 70%+ will take quiz on mobile devices
Nurture Sequence Tiers:
- Basic: 5-email educational series
- Premium: 10-email series + resource library access
- VIP: Personalized video + 1:1 consultation offer
